Bloodlines of the Bayou: Bound to Ma Fille by Nee Scott
"Some scars run deeper than blood, and some love stories never die-even when they should." Iraj thought she left the pain behind when she traded the 9th Ward for the lights of Los Angeles. A successful therapist by day, she's built a new life with a new man. But ten years after the tragic murder of her daughter and the sudden disappearance of her husband, the past refuses to stay buried. Now, back in New Orleans for a business trip-turned-emotional reckoning, Iraj finds herself haunted by a city full of ghosts-some real, some imagined, and one that still wears the face of the man who left her when she needed him most. As memories resurface and truths unravel, Iraj must confront the questions she's avoided for a Why did Nuh abandon her? What really happened that day? And can you ever truly escape a love that's written in blood? Bloodlines of the Bound to Ma Fille is a gripping tale of love, trauma, and resilience set against the vibrant soul of New Orleans-a city where nothing stays dead for long.
